# Method Name: # Filename: simple_source/stmts/04_raise.py # Argument count: 0 # Keyword-only arguments: 0 # Number of locals: 0 # Stack size: 1 # Flags: 0x00000040 (NOFREE) # First Line: 6 # Constants: # 0: , line 6 # 1: None # Names: # 0: compact_traceback 6: 0 LOAD_CONST (, line 6) 3 MAKE_FUNCTION (0 default parameters) 6 STORE_NAME (compact_traceback) 9 LOAD_CONST (None) 12 RETURN_VALUE # Method Name: compact_traceback # Filename: simple_source/stmts/04_raise.py # Argument count: 1 # Keyword-only arguments: 0 # Number of locals: 1 # Stack size: 2 # Flags: 0x00000043 (NOFREE | NEWLOCALS | OPTIMIZED) # First Line: 6 # Constants: # 0: None # 1: 'traceback does not exist' # Names: # 0: AssertionError # Varnames: # tb # Positional arguments: # tb 7: 0 LOAD_FAST (tb) 3 JUMP_IF_TRUE (to 22) 6 POP_TOP 8: 7 LOAD_GLOBAL (AssertionError) 10 LOAD_CONST ('traceback does not exist') 13 CALL_FUNCTION (1 positional, 0 named) 16 RAISE_VARARGS 1 19 JUMP_FORWARD (to 23) >> 22 POP_TOP 9: >> 23 LOAD_CONST (None) 26 RETURN_VALUE